云存储同步工具rclone:从零开始快速上手指南
【免费下载链接】rclone 项目地址: https://gitcode.com/gh_mirrors/rcl/rclone
云存储同步工具rclone是一款强大的跨平台文件管理神器,支持超过40种云存储服务,让你在不同云端之间轻松实现文件同步和备份。无论你是开发者还是普通用户,掌握rclone都能极大提升你的工作效率。
为什么选择rclone?
在日常工作中,你可能会遇到以下困扰:
- 多个云存储账户之间文件同步困难
- 大文件上传下载速度缓慢
- 需要定期备份重要数据到云端
- 希望将云存储挂载为本地磁盘使用
rclone正是为解决这些问题而生,它具备以下核心优势:
| 功能特点 | 具体描述 |
|---|---|
| 跨平台支持 | Windows、macOS、Linux全平台兼容 |
| 多协议支持 | 覆盖Google Drive、Dropbox、OneDrive等主流服务 |
| 高效传输 | 支持多线程和断点续传 |
| 灵活配置 | 命令行操作,自动化程度高 |
快速安装rclone
一键安装方法
根据你的操作系统选择合适的安装方式:
Windows系统:
- 下载预编译的二进制文件
- 解压到任意目录
- 将目录添加到系统PATH环境变量
macOS系统:
brew install rclone
Linux系统:
# Ubuntu/Debian
sudo apt-get install rclone
# CentOS/RHEL
sudo yum install rclone
源码编译安装
如果你希望获得最新功能,可以从源码编译:
git clone https://gitcode.com/gh_mirrors/rcl/rclone
cd rclone
go build
编译成功后,会在当前目录生成rclone可执行文件。
配置你的第一个云存储
初始化配置
运行配置命令开始设置:
rclone config
系统会引导你完成以下步骤:
- 选择新建远程配置
- 从支持的云存储列表中选择服务类型
- 按照提示输入必要的认证信息
常用云存储配置示例
Google Drive配置:
- 选择drive类型
- 使用默认client_id和client_secret
- 按照浏览器提示完成OAuth认证
本地磁盘配置:
- 选择local类型
- 指定本地目录路径
核心功能实战操作
文件同步功能
单向同步(本地到云端):
rclone sync /本地/文件夹 remote:云端文件夹
双向同步:
rclone bisync /本地/文件夹 remote:云端文件夹
文件管理操作
| 操作类型 | 命令示例 | 功能说明 |
|---|---|---|
| 列出文件 | rclone ls remote: | 显示云端文件列表 |
| 复制文件 | rclone copy remote:文件 /本地路径 | 下载云端文件 |
| 删除文件 | rclone delete remote:文件 | 删除云端文件 |
| 创建目录 | rclone mkdir remote:新文件夹 | 在云端创建目录 |
高级功能应用
挂载云存储为本地磁盘:
rclone mount remote:云端文件夹 /本地挂载点
增量备份:
rclone sync /重要数据 remote:备份文件夹 --backup-dir remote:历史版本
最佳实践与效率提升
配置文件优化
编辑配置文件~/.config/rclone/rclone.conf,可以设置以下参数:
- 传输速度限制:避免占用全部带宽
- 重试次数:提高网络不稳定时的成功率
- 并发连接数:根据网络状况调整
自动化脚本示例
创建定时备份脚本:
#!/bin/bash
# 每日凌晨执行数据同步
rclone sync /home/user/Documents remote:文档备份
常见问题解决指南
安装问题
- 找不到命令:确保rclone所在目录已添加到PATH
- 权限不足:使用sudo权限执行命令
配置问题
- 认证失败:检查API密钥和访问令牌
- 连接超时:调整网络代理设置
使用问题
- 同步速度慢:增加
--transfers参数值 - 内存占用高:减少
--buffer-size参数值
进阶技巧与资源
性能优化建议
- 使用
--checkers和--transfers参数调整并发数 - 启用
--fast-list选项减少API调用次数 - 设置合适的
--bwlimit带宽限制
项目资源参考
- 详细文档:docs/content/
- 后端支持列表:backend/
- 命令行工具:cmd/
通过本指南,你已经掌握了rclone的核心使用方法。从简单的文件同步到高级的自动化备份,rclone都能成为你云存储管理的得力助手。开始使用rclone,让文件管理变得更简单高效!
【免费下载链接】rclone 项目地址: https://gitcode.com/gh_mirrors/rcl/rclone
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考




